AWS 복제된 EC2 인스턴스가 원래 인스턴스로 다시 라우팅됨

AWS 복제된 EC2 인스턴스가 원래 인스턴스로 다시 라우팅됨

탄력적 IP 주소 및 연결된 도메인 이름에 연결된 OpenEMR Cloud Express 5.0.1을 실행하는 EC2 인스턴스가 있습니다. 최근에 작업 -> 이미지 생성을 사용하여 인스턴스를 복제한 다음 해당 이미지를 사용하여 인스턴스를 시작했습니다. 복제된 인스턴스의 IP 주소를 복사하여 주소 표시줄에 붙여 넣으면 원본 인스턴스의 도메인 이름으로 리디렉션되고 변경 사항은 원본 인스턴스에만 영향을 미칩니다. 복제된 인스턴스에 SSH로 연결하면 웹 앱을 통해 추가된 모든 새 데이터가 거기에 없습니다.

리디렉션의 원인과 해결 방법이 무엇인지 궁금합니다. 몇 가지 테스트를 실행하고 업데이트를 연습하려면 복제 인스턴스가 원본 인스턴스와 완전히 분리되어 작동해야 합니다.

도움을 주셔서 감사합니다.

답변1

추측일 뿐입니다. 하지만 무슨 일이 일어나고 있는지는 DNS와 관련이 있는 것 같습니다.

1) You type in the new IP, 
2) The new instance loads up and redirects you by name (either http->https or some other redirection reason)
3) Your browser resolves the name to the old IP
4) You're now looking at the old instance in your browser.
5) Failbeans :-(```

이 경우 가장 쉬운 해결 방법은 해당 이름이 새 IP가 되도록 호스트 항목을 로컬로 추가하는 것입니다. 그런 다음 이를 짧은 시간 동안 유지하거나 시간이 더 긴 경우 사이트 이름을 변경하고 새로운 DNS 항목입니다.

컬을 사용하여 IP를 로드하고 301 또는 302를 얻는 경우 이것이 원인일 수 있습니다.

curl -I 123.123.123.123

답변2

문제는 SSL 리디렉션이었습니다. 복제 인스턴스의 웹 앱에 접근하기 위해 해야 할 일은 IP 주소 앞에 https://를 넣는 것뿐이었습니다.

관련 정보